Fostering creativity through the arts primarily enhances the understanding of complex concepts. Engaging with artistic activities—whether through visual arts, music, or performance—encourages learners to think critically and interpret ideas in multifaceted ways. The arts allow individuals to explore different perspectives, leading to a deeper cognitive engagement with subject matter, as they learn to express and transform their thoughts into creative forms.

Moreover, creative processes often involve problem-solving, innovation, and the ability to see relationships between various concepts, which are essential skills for comprehending complex ideas. By integrating arts into education, students are more likely to develop a nuanced understanding of subjects, as they can connect abstract theories with tangible, imaginative expressions. This enhancement of understanding through creativity can lead to a more holistic educational experience that stimulates both intellect and emotional development.
